A cross between a labrador and a miniature poodle, the mini labradoodle comes in many colors, sizes, and personalities. As a crossbreed, the mini labradoodle can display a range of appearances and traits, influenced by their labrador retriever and miniature poodle parentage.

Mini poodles usually weigh between 10 and 15 pounds, which means the potential weight range for an f1 miniature poodle is staggeringly wide.
But, crossing a petite f1 mini labradoodle with another miniature poodle greatly increases the probability of reliably small f1b mini labradoodle puppies. Miniature australian labradoodles were initially created to be hypoallergenic guide dogs for disabled people with allergies.
Now considered the ideal family pet, mini labradoodles give unconditional love and companionship. The confirmed and approved parent breeds of the australian labradoodle are the poodle: Standard, miniature, toy, labrador retriever, irish water spaniel, curly coat retriever, american cocker spaniel and english cocker spaniel.
